fungal nucleic acids as interferon inducers.nucleic acids isolated from the fungi aspergillus niger x11, piptoporus betulinus and ganoderma applanatum reduced the number of vaccinia virus plaques in chick embryo fibroblast (cef) tissue culture and when administered intravenously to white mice protected them against lethal infection with tick borne encephalitis virus strain k5 (tbe). in cef tissue culture the nucleic acids of the studied fungi were found to induce small but detectable amounts of a substance with the character of interferon ...197994746
studies of rna isolated from piptoporus betulinus as interferon inducer.crude rna isolated from piptoporus betulinus and two fractions of it obtained after the chromatography contain single-stranded rna. the crude rna, but not its chromatographic fractions, are resistant to the pancreatic rna-ase. the crude preparation of rna from p. betulinus contains beside ribose, considerable amounts of glucose, galactose and mannose. the crude rna from p. betulinus induces in the human fibroblasts interferon with specific activity of 400 units per mg of protein.1978219808

novel hydroquinone as a matrix metallo-proteinase inhibitor from the mushroom, piptoporus betulinus.the novel hydroquinone, (e)-2-(4-hydroxy-3-methyl-2-butenyl)-hydroquinone, and known compound, polyporenic acid c, were isolated as matrix metallo-proteinase inhibitors from the mushroom, piptoporus betulinus.200212596882
anti-inflammatory lanostane-type triterpene acids from piptoporus betulinus.six lanostane-type triterpene acids were isolated from the fruiting bodies of piptoporus betulinus. they were identified as polyporenic acids a (1) and c (2), three derivatives of polyporenic acid a (3-5), and a novel compound, (+)-12 alpha,28-dihydroxy-3 alpha-(3'-hydroxy-3'-methylglutaryloxy)-24-methyllanosta-8,24(31)-dien-26-oic acid (6). all these compounds suppressed the 12-o-tetradecanoylphorbol-13-acetate (tpa)-induced edema on mouse ears by 49-86% with a 400 nmol/ear application.200312932134

degradation of cellulose and hemicelluloses by the brown rot fungus piptoporus betulinus--production of extracellular enzymes and characterization of the major cellulases.piptoporus betulinus is a common wood-rotting fungus parasitic for birch (betula species). it is able to cause fast mass loss of birch wood or other lignocellulose substrates. when grown on wheat straw, p. betulinus caused 65% loss of dry mass within 98 days, and it produced endo-1,4-beta-glucanase (eg), endo-1,4-beta-xylanase, endo-1,4-beta-mannanase, 1,4-beta-glucosidase (bg), 1,4-beta-xylosidase, 1,4-beta-mannosidase and cellobiohydrolase activities. the fungus was not able to efficiently deg ...200617159214

intraspecific variability in growth response to cadmium of the wood-rotting fungus piptoporus betulinus.the intraspecific variability in growth response to cadmium (cd) on agar media and in liquid culture was studied among fourteen strains of a wood-rotting fungus piptoporus betulinus. the variability of cd tolerance was found to be very high. the ed(50) ranged from 6.8 μm cd in the most sensitive strain, up to 255.1 μm in the most resistant one. on agar media the addition of cd to nutrient media resulted in reduction of relative growth rate and increased lag time. while the reduction of growth ra ...200221156514
